| NOUN | plant | bonduc, Kentucky coffee tree, chicot, Gymnocladus dioica | handsome tree of central and eastern North America having large bipinnate leaves and green-white flowers followed by large woody brown pods whose seeds are used as a coffee substitute |
|---|---|---|---|
| plant | bonduc, bonduc tree, Caesalpinia bonduc, Caesalpinia bonducella | tropical tree with large prickly pods of seeds that resemble beans and are used for jewelry and rosaries |
